Singer Kanika Kapoor Tests Positive For Coronavirus, Kept In Isolation At Govt Hospital

Bollywood singer Kanika Kapoor, who belted the popular tune Baby Doll Mein Sone Di and many other popular numbers, is one of the first Indian celebrities who has been tested positive for COVID-19. 

She took to Instagram to confirm the news, and wrote, “Hello everyone, For the past 4 days I have had signs of flu, I got myself tested and it came positive for Covid-19. My family and I are in complete quarantine now and following medical advice on how to move forward. Contact mapping of people I have been in touch with is underway as well.”

She said that she was scanned at the airport as per normal procedure around 10 days ago when she returned home from London, but she started developing symptoms only four days ago. She also urged all her fans to practice self-isolation, and to get tested if anyone experiences any symptoms.

She added, “I am feeling ok, like a normal flu and a mild fever, however we need to be sensible citizens at this time and think of all around us. We can get through this without panic only if we listen to the experts and our local, state and central government directives.”

Kanika’s father Rajiv Kapoor spoke to a leading daily about her situation. He said, “After she started developing some symptoms similar to Covid19 she herself informed the chief medical officers and her samples were taken. Today she was confirmed positive. The team of doctors have taken her to Sanjay Gandhi Post Graduate Institute of Medical Sciences (SGPGI) and she has been kept in isolation.”

He also revealed that she had recently attended a function in Kanpur and two in Lucknow recently. The doctors are saying the intensity is low and she will recover soon. “We all are taking full care and following what we are told,” he added.

At present, India has 206 active cases of COID-19, with over 6,700 contacts being monitored. Four Indian citizens and one Italian national have succumbed to the virus.
